On the 22nd of July 2001, the Psychodrama Institute of Melbourne emerged. In May, 2001, urged on by many people to start a training institute, an idea emerged in me. The idea expanded as we talked and discussed and dreamt. Look what happened. PIM was born and here we are still!
While PIM is a psychodrama training institute, covering the methods of role training, role theory and its various applications, sociometry, sociodrama and groupwork, the training groups provide a haven, a place of growth and an opportunity to be part of something for each person. Together we created and continue to create PIM. We are affiliated with La Trobe University, Masters in Counselling Course, in the School of Public Health. From PIM came the Friends of PIM (FoPIM) and then the Moreno Psychodrama Society. Later, the Advisory and Assessment Board of Psychodrama came into being - now the Australian/Aotearoa Board of Psychodrama. We've given birth to reading groups, interest groups, including the latest children and adolescents interest group, writing groups and two conferences, including an International Psychodrama Conference in 2006, pictures of which you can still see on the PIM website:
www.psychodrama-institute-melbourne.com
We published a newsletter Social Atom News, which later, gave way to this blog, the e-newsletter of MPS and PIM. We developed the Theatre of Spontaneity, which is in its second year and the only sociodramatic event, which is run monthly and open to the public, in the world. In the library there are 79 articles, written by trainees and practitioners and trainers over these 7 years.
